This robotic 3D laser cutting machine combines 6-axis industrial robot and high-precision fiber laser technology. It realizes multi-angle and omnidirectional 3D processing for curved parts, special-shaped tubes and complex structural components. It completes trimming, punching and profiling procedures efficiently with outstanding flexibility and automation performance, widely used in automotive, aerospace, mold and construction machinery industries.

Key Advantages

Why choose Robotic 3D Laser Cutting Machine?

 

  • 6-Axis Robot Flexible Operation

    Equipped with high-performance six-axis industrial robot for multi-angle swinging and rotating. It achieves dead-angle-free cutting for all kinds of complex three-dimensional workpieces.

  • Advanced Laser & Robot Integration

    Fiber laser perfectly matches robotic motion system for stable laser output. It maintains consistent high precision during long-term automated production.

  • Multiple Processing Functions

    Integrates trimming, punching and one-time profiling forming functions. It simplifies production procedures and reduces intermediate handling steps of workpieces.

  • Strong Workpiece Adaptability

    Easily handles curved panels, shaped tubes and abnormal structural parts. It solves difficult processing problems that traditional flat cutting machines cannot complete.

  • High Automated Production

    Intelligent robotic operation reduces manual intervention effectively. It improves production consistency and greatly saves labor costs for enterprises.

  • Wide Industrial Compatibility

    Suitable for automotive, aerospace, mold and engineering machinery fields. It meets high-standard 3D processing demands of high-end manufacturing industries.
